Cocktail Party Effect
The ability to focus on one auditory input while filtering out a vast range of other stimuli, as when listening to one conversation in a noisy room.
Inattentional Blindness
A psychological lack of attention that is not associated with vision defects or deficits, causing individuals to fail to perceive an unexpected stimulus that is in plain sight.
Dual Processing
The principle that our mind operates on two levels simultaneously, conscious and unconscious thinking.
